Як усунути неполадки PiCamera на Fedora та Raspberry Pi

Камера Pi для Raspberry Pi

Багато з вас використовують Raspbian або Noobs для управління вашим Raspberry Pi та його аксесуарами. Однак все більше і більше користувачів шукають інші альтернативи. Дуже хороші альтернативи, але які не працюють у Фонді Raspberry Pi, і з цим завжди виникають проблеми між компонентами Raspberry Pi та Fedora.

Проблема у всьому цьому полягає перш за все в тому, що ядро Fedora чи інших дистрибутивів не створено для Raspberry Pi але для ARM-платформ, що створює деякі проблеми, а деякі файли або продуктивність пристрою відсутні.

Кілька користувачів виникли проблеми між їх PiCam та їх Fedora, тому вони не можуть змусити цей компонент Raspberry Pi працювати, хоча решта програмного забезпечення працює ідеально. Це легко виправити і не передбачає зміни операційної системи.

Fedora не створена для платформ Raspberry Pi або таких аксесуарів, як PiCamera

Щоб це вирішити, спочатку потрібно відкрити термінал і спробувати запустити скрипт python ./take_photo.py, в кінці з'явиться бібліотека, що видає помилку, в цьому випадку вона називається libmmal.so. Цю бібліотеку можна знайти в операційній системі Fedora, але певні програми та програми не можуть отримати доступ до її розташування. Щоб вирішити цю проблему, просто напишіть такі рядки:

echo “/opt/vc/lib/”>/etc/ld.so.conf.d/rpi.conf
ldconfig

Перша команда призводить до того, що файл, рівний бібліотеці, створюється в іншому місці, ніж якщо він доступний для інших програм. І друга команда, що вона робить, - це попереджати все програмне забезпечення, що це місце вже доступне, і використовувати його. Отже, коли ми знову запускаємо сценарій PiCámara, ми можемо змусити камеру працювати без проблем, і все у Fedora, цікава альтернатива Raspbian, хоча багатьом це не подобається.

Джерело - Tonet666P